Ok, domain names are kept on DNS servers. The 'localhost' name which routes to 127.0.0...... is specified in the hosts file.
But, where is the computer name associated to the 127.0.0.... ie local address?
For example, if I type in 'Rick1' on any pc connected to my LAN, it routes to this PC - but how does it know to?
Cheers